Description
English: Pumping of hid-1(yg316) mutant exposed to 10% CO2. Pumping rate of hid-1(yg316) mutant animal under dissecting microscope is presented. Worms are first exposed to normal air and then exposed to 10% CO2.
Date
Source Movie S2 from Sharabi K, Charar C, Friedman N, Mizrahi I, Zaslaver A, Sznajder J, Gruenbaum Y (2014). "The Response to High CO2 Levels Requires the Neuropeptide Secretion Component HID-1 to Promote Pumping Inhibition". PLOS Genetics. DOI:10.1371/journal.pgen.1004529. PMID 25101962. PMC: 4125093.
